I was barely 7 years old when Britney Spears rose to fame in the late 90s, I remember everyone going crazy for her, she was the biggest thing back then. I was the youngest of my sisters who were in their preteen/teen years at the time so I joined in on their obsession of the teen pop star. We would hang out in my sisters’ room and sing along to her “Baby One More Time” album back to back in ’99 and in 2000 we tuned in to MTV every afternoon to wait for her “Oops! I did it again” video, reciting the iconic dialogue in the middle of the video:

“But I thought the old lady dropped it into the ocean in the end

Well baby, I went down and got it for you

Aww, you shouldn’t have”.

Though, I was too young to realize it at the time, Britney Spears was the ultimate teen pop star and no one ever came close to her. She sang, danced and even did a backflip or two onstage. She also was the epitome of the late 90s/early 2000s style: her hair, makeup, and clothes were everything. Every interview she gave, she was the sweetest, kindest, and most polite. I admit for whatever reason, after 2000, I didn’t follow her as much even though she was as famous as ever. In fact, I wasn’t even aware of the details of her messy break up with Justin Timberlake until I watched the documentary “Framing Britney Spears” earlier this year.

Watching the documentary, my heart hurt for her. It made me realize how far she’d fallen from grace through the media’s constant harassment and cruel portrayal of her during the breakup. Yet she took it in great strides, never bashing Justin for revealing the intimate parts of their relationship so he could build his solo career off of that. Watching her old videos also made me realize how animated and bight eyed she once was, she had the world at her fingertips and now has sadness in her eyes.

In her 2003 video of “Everytime” she paints us a picture of what she was truly feeling. It shows her in despair, being chased and abused by paparazzi, being ignored by a loved one and hurting herself, eventually committing suicide. In the video the only time she smiles is when she has passed away, as if a huge weight has been lifted off her shoulders. As chilling and heartbreaking as the video was, I am relieved she is still with us.

I truly am heartbroken for where she is today and imagine a parallel universe where she never dated Justin, never married Kevin, had a caring and loving family and never let anyone who didn’t deserve it have access to her like that because that’s what ultimately broke her spirit. I imagine a parallel universe where she had at least one person who was genuinely in her corner without an ulterior motive, someone who cared about her, unconditionally loved her enough then she wouldn’t have had that meltdown in 2007 and she wouldn’t have been forced into this abusive conservatorship.

I watch her old videos and see how sweet of a girl she is, sadly she wore her heart on her sleeves for the vultures to peck at. I also see how lonely she already was back then, how she ate lunch by herself on tour because her family or anyone her age wasn’t around and how in interviews she always longed for a family of her own at a young age. She looked for love from all the wrong people because she didn’t have that despite having the fame, money and adoring fans. I believe that’s why she married Kevin, thinking this is how she can make the dream of having her own family come true, a dream that was short-lived. It pains me how we all criminalized her in 2007 and called her crazy, how we went from loving and adoring her to looking down on her and making her the butt of all jokes. I am truly horrified at how we all treated her. Despite all the hardships she went through and still going through, she is still here, fighting and surviving.

I hope she gets her life back and her happy, fairytale ending. I hope she is able to have her own loving family and have her peace. I hope her conservatorship comes to an end and I sincerely hope to Free Britney. #FreeBritney
